2003 JUN 19 - (NewsRx.com & NewsRx.net) -- Proxima Therapeutics, Inc., a developer and marketer of site-specific therapies that deliver internal radiation treatment, has received marketing clearance from the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) for a new, larger-sized MammoSite balloon catheter.
MammoSite, an internal radiation therapy delivery system for breast cancer, will now include the option of a spherical balloon catheter capable of expanding 5-6 cm in diameter. The larger balloon catheter will enable women with larger tumor cavities to be eligible for this treatment. The smaller 4-5 cm balloon catheter will continue to be available.
Breast conservation therapy, a less invasive course of treatment than mastectomy, typically involves tumor excision via lumpectomy followed by radiation therapy to reduce the likelihood of recurrence.
